Main duties of the jobThe successful candidate will participate in the 1:8 full shift rota providing cover for both Obstetrics and Gynaecology in a three-tier system. The night on-call team comprises an SHO , two registrars and a Consultant. The consultant is resident from 0800 - 2200 to support high-quality care and outstanding training opportunities.
